The user interface buttons stop working in Internet Explorer 8 on a computer that is running Windows 7 or Windows Server 2008 R2


View products that this article applies to.

Symptoms

Assume that you browse a website for some time by using Windows Internet Explorer 8 on a computer that is running Windows 7 or Windows Server 2008 R2. In this situation, the user interface buttons (such as the Back button or the Forward button) in Internet Explorer 8 stop working.

Note You must restart the main window (frame process) of Internet Explorer 8 to recover from this issue.

↑ Back to the top


Cause

This issue occurs because of a resource leak in Internet Explorer 8. When you browse websites that trigger this resource leak while the frame process is running, this issue occurs.

Note By default, the Loosely Coupled Internet Explorer (LCIE) feature is enabled in Internet Explorer 8. When the LCIE feature is enabled, the frame process may continue to run until Windows is shut down or restarted.

Prerequisites

To apply this hotfix, you must be running one of the following operating systems:
  • Windows 7
  • Windows 7 Service Pack 1 (SP1)
  • Windows Server 2008 R2
  • Windows Server 2008 R2 Service Pack 1 (SP1)

Registry information

To use the hotfix in this package, you do not have to make any changes to the registry.

Restart requirement

You must restart the computer after you apply this hotfix.

Hotfix replacement information

This hotfix does not replace a previously released hotfix.
